Need Help Finding a Lender?

We encourage you to start with your local bank with whom you already have your existing business account as many banks are, because of demand, being forced to limit application processing for PPP loans to existing customers.  The S.B.A. has a search tool to help you find nearby lenders, but — again — they may not take new customers.

Some lenders have said they will work with new customers. They include Kabbage, an online lender that teamed up with a bank; NorthOne, a digital bank that is funding its loans through Radius Bank; and Ready Capital, a nonbank lender already approved to make S.B.A. loans.
